    What is your cruise speed?

    Between 50-55 is a very comfortable efficient cruise speed for me, the engines are turning around 3500-3600 rpm. Above 4000 rpm, fuel economy drops like a rock.

    Hallett 270 Straight and Stepped Bottom.

    I'm pretty sure that there was a period of time where both bottoms were offered. I've spent a good amount of time in an early 2000's straight bottom 270 and it's a great all around boat. I have never ridden in a stepped bottom 270, but have heard that they are a "drivers boat" so to speak.
